I picked up this 1857 flying Eagle today, I am hoping I got it at a good price. I think it has some good detail, but the motto is very weak or maybe Struck Through Grease. Any opinions on this, or grade and value would be helpful.

Way stronger than F-12 imo.... I think it only has XF wear, but strike issues would bring it down to high VF-30/35 market grade. Nice lookin coin!

This was struck on a misaligned die and ended up with a very poor strike. It looks like a VF/XF coin as far as wear goes. Maybe XF40.

It's definitely got strike issues. It was weakly struck that would account for the "mushy" reverse details. Obverse has XF45 details but I would downgrade due to the overall strike to XF40. CDN bid is $95
